Diverse Investment Options for All Risk Tolerances
Navigating the world of investment can seem daunting, but today’s market offers a diverse range of options tailored to various risk tolerances. For conservative investors, bonds and treasury securities provide stable returns with lower risk. In contrast, moderate investors might explore balanced mutual funds or exchange-traded funds (ETFs) that combine equity and fixed-income investments, fostering growth while maintaining some safety. Aggressive investors, on the other hand, are often drawn to stocks, particularly in emerging markets or technology sectors, where the potential for high returns exists alongside higher volatility. Additionally, alternatives like real estate funds and commodities can further diversify portfolios, ensuring that there’s an investment strategy to suit everyone’s financial goals and risk preferences.

Building a Balanced Portfolio: What You Need to Know
Building a balanced portfolio is essential for effective investment management and risk mitigation. A well-structured portfolio typically includes a mix of asset classes, such as stocks, bonds, and alternative investments, which can help stabilize returns and reduce volatility. When constructing your portfolio, consider your risk tolerance, investment goals, and time horizon. Diversification is key; by spreading investments across different sectors and geographic regions, you can minimize the impact of a poor-performing asset. Regularly reviewing and rebalancing your portfolio is also crucial to maintain your desired asset allocation. Stay informed about market trends and adjust your strategy as needed to ensure long-term financial success.

Staying Informed: Resources for Savvy Investors
Staying informed is crucial for savvy investors seeking to navigate the ever-changing financial landscape. A wealth of resources is available to help sharpen investment strategies and enhance decision-making. Financial news platforms such as Bloomberg, CNBC, and The Wall Street Journal deliver timely updates on market trends and economic news. Additionally, investment research firms like Morningstar and YCharts provide in-depth analysis of stocks and mutual funds. Podcasts and webinars hosted by experienced investors offer valuable insights and tips. Social media platforms like Twitter and LinkedIn can also serve as tools for engaging with financial communities. By leveraging these resources, investors can make more informed choices and better manage their portfolios.
